Add 63/45 and 42/8
1st number: 1 18/45, 2nd number: 5 2/8
63/45 + 42/8 is 133/20.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 45 and 8 is 360
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 360 - For the 1st fraction, since 45 × 8 = 360,
63/45 = 63 × 8/45 × 8 = 504/360 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 8 × 45 = 360,
42/8 = 42 × 45/8 × 45 = 1890/360 - Add the two like fractions:
504/360 + 1890/360 = 504 + 1890/360 = 2394/360 - 2394/360 simplified gives 133/20
- So, 63/45 + 42/8 = 133/20
